Ticket: PAY-1142 — Config drift causing flaky integration tests

Welcome, new folks — this one bites everyone eventually. The Cobblepay integration suite fails intermittently because the CI runners drifted from the canonical settings after the Drayford migration. Timeouts and retry counts differ between runners, so the same test passes on one box and fails on another. The canonical configuration the runners should match is below.

settings of yahag-yafog:
[pramir]
host = pramir.qirvancorp.internal
user = pramir_svc
database = pramir_prod

The new release drops plaintext auth entirely, so every
# consumer in the Fenwick pipeline must present broker credentials at connect
# time rather than relying on the old network allowlist. Marisol verified the
# failover pair in the Oakmere cluster already accepts the new handshake.
# Rotate locally before Thursday's cutover rehearsal. The broker credential
# for the staging vhost is set on the next line.

sealed setting: VAULT_KEY20=c8ea1e419912889df6b4

**[TICKET-HOLLYGLEN] Expired creds blocking the Petrel migration rehearsal**

Quick heads-up for the sync: the dual-write rehearsal for the zero-downtime schema migration on Petrel stalled last night because the shadow-table writer's credentials expired mid-run. Backfill is fine, nothing was lost, but we can't validate the cutover window until the writer can auth again. Marisol re-issued a fresh credential this morning. For the rehearsal runner, use the key below.

gateway credential: kto3_qfe